ADMIN For Sale section now split into "members" and "not mine" forums

I've split the "66-77 Broncos For Sale" forum into two. One is for members who are selling their Broncos. The other is for all the "not mine" posts where people post Broncos they see on eBay, Craigslist, etc.

I don't have any problem with people posting "not mine" type ads, but they were drowning out the ads posted by members. So now they're in two sections.

Thanks to several members for making the suggestion.
